The problem may be the juices. It was giving off this awful burning taste, even after changing the atty head, cleaning, etc. Apparently, according to the people of YouTube, these don't really like VG. And I've been doing a lot of VG lately. What I did was I now only fill the tank about half way, and give it a flick every few pulls to pop bubbles and loosen the vacuum. Seems to have fixed the problem. Next order I'll probably ask for PG - or mostly PG - instead to fix the issue. But I'll probably switch over fairly soon and use this as a backup system. New Pet Hate discovered today: head shops.

I'm down to my last Mistic (dse901-ish) battery and was looking for something to tide me over until my next step comes in, just in case the last one decides to fry too (the gaskets b/t the terminals are wearing out…they're supposed to be semi-disposable). Out of 4 head shops I tried, three of them sold Joye Ego starter kits (either unbranded or Titan branded). And the cheapest one (650 mAh battery, one atty, no juice and a carrying case) cost $150……and the sales lady didn't know you could use liquid with it.

I know that VaporPro lists that as their "retail price", but it was a lamer kit and it's not like anyone pays more than what's listed as "wholesale" when buying online anyway.

I was floored. You can get a kicked silver bullet for that price.

I can't imagine how many people think PVs or ecigs just have to suck if they're not savvy enough to type "electronic cigarette" into a search engine.
